G.B. Cassano is a scholar working on Clinical Psychology, Cellular and Molecular Neuroscience and Psychiatry and Mental health. According to data from OpenAlex, G.B. Cassano has authored 33 papers receiving a total of 653 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 10 papers in Clinical Psychology, 9 papers in Cellular and Molecular Neuroscience and 9 papers in Psychiatry and Mental health. Recurrent topics in G.B. Cassano's work include Bipolar Disorder and Treatment (5 papers), Neurotransmitter Receptor Influence on Behavior (5 papers) and Anxiety, Depression, Psychometrics, Treatment, Cognitive Processes (4 papers). G.B. Cassano is often cited by papers focused on Bipolar Disorder and Treatment (5 papers), Neurotransmitter Receptor Influence on Behavior (5 papers) and Anxiety, Depression, Psychometrics, Treatment, Cognitive Processes (4 papers). G.B. Cassano collaborates with scholars based in Italy, United States and Slovenia. G.B. Cassano's co-authors include Giulio Perugi, Donatella Marazziti, Antonio Tundo, Michela Ori, Irma Nardi, Massimo Pasqualetti, Maura Castagna, Franco Frare, Stefano Pini and Martin Roth and has published in prestigious journals such as Neuroscience, Journal of Affective Disorders and Life Sciences.
